[QUOTE="Valentinian, post: 3581667, member: 44316"][USER=104286]@lucag123[/USER] , if you take photos of dark coins on a white background you may have difficulty getting the details of the coins to show--the coins come out too dark in comparison to the white background. Experts can discuss coin photography endlessly, but for your immediate purposes take the photos on a black background or gray. They won't be top quality photos, but the coins will then not be too dark to see.
